Understanding Short-Term Care in Pittsburgh

Short-term care provides temporary assistance for seniors and adults who need support for a limited period. It can help families manage changing care needs, caregiver breaks, recovery periods, or unexpected situations while maintaining comfort and safety at home.

Common Questions About Short-term care in Pittsburgh

Short-term, non-medical home care in Pittsburgh typically costs $25–$36 per hour, with most agencies setting a 4-hour minimum. Multi-day care after a hospital discharge or surgery is often billed as a flat daily rate instead, which is usually more cost-effective. Price depends on the level of care needed, time of day, and length of the assignment. Rita’s Home Care confirms your exact rate after a short assessment.

Costs vary based on schedule and care complexity. Transparent pricing is discussed during consultation.

Medicare does not cover non-medical in-home respite care services.
